SPYFLIX is a new spy movie and tv festival focused on secrets presented by our friends at SPYSCAPE. Spybrary host Shane Whaley got together with SPYSCAPE's Marketing Director, Francis Jago to find out more.

The SPYFLIX festival will highlight new voices and stories focused on secrets. The festival is now accepting submissions through 28 February 2021 and will kick off screenings starting 18 April 2021…

What is SPYFLIX?

SPYFLIX is an innovative new film and tv festival, showcasing new voices and new stories focused on the oldest storytelling device of all: secrets. Awards and cash prizes for features, shorts and episodic content.

Secrets intrigue us, and they make great stories. Their universal appeal lies deep in our psyche. Inside each secret is a structured who, what, how & why that powers franchises from James Bond to Batman, and from Harry Potter to Sherlock Holmes.

Secrets also power factual stories across news and current affairs, history and politics. Our panel of writers, directors, producers and secret intelligence professionals (spies!) will select new work for awards with major cash prizes, and screening in our online festival.
